FLEXURAL BUCKLING STRENGTH OF H-SHAPED SECTION BRACING REINFORCED BY WELDING ADDITIONAL PLATES OVER MIDDLE PORTION

Abstract

In the case of H-shaped section bracing, the flexural buckling strength can be improved by increasing the cross section over the middle portion. For example, the increase in sections is accomplished by welding additional plates. The compression tests in inelastic ranges were conducted on the pin-ended columns reinforced H-shaped section by welding plates. The buckling behavior and the mode are examined for the members having a variety of proportion. It is found that the corresponding buckling strength can be larger than the column curve of the design standard for steel structures.
